    In 1996, Advocates for Justice and Education, Inc. (AJE) was created to increase parental participation in their children's education. AJE's mission is to empower families, youth, and the community to be effective advocates to ensure that children and youth - particularly those with disabilities and special health care needs - receive access to appropriate education and health services. AJE has designed all its programs and services to increase parents' knowledge and capacity to advocate for their children and build community power to achieve systems change, eliminate barriers, and dismantle educational and health inequities in DC. We utilize a multi-strategy approach to achieve our mission: Direct Services to address a family's immediate issue; Training to increase parents' knowledge and capacity to self-advocate; and Advocacy, in partnership with families and other stakeholder partners, to bring about systemic changes through policy, legislation, and litigation.

    PRINCIPAL RESPONSIBILITIES:

    This description incorporates the core responsibilities of the position. It is recognized that other related duties not specifically mentioned might also be performed and that not all responsibilities may be carried out depending on operational needs. Additionally, this position has flexible hours and a non-traditional work schedule (working some evenings and weekends will be necessary).

    The incumbent in this position will:

    • Design, plan, and execute youth programs focusing on leadership development, health and education advocacy, life skills, and community involvement.
    • Tailor programs to the needs of youth with disabilities and special health care needs.
    • Provide training and resources that enable young people to transition from pediatric to adult care and to self-advocate for their rights in areas such as education, health care, and social services.
    • Organize and facilitate workshops, seminars, and events that address topics such as self-advocacy, leadership, career planning, and health equity.
    • Build relationships with community partners and represent AJE in coalitions advancing the interest of youth.
    • Conduct outreach to recruit participants, especially targeting underrepresented youth populations.
    • Develop marketing strategies, including social media outreach and community engagement, to raise awareness of youth programs and opportunities.
    • Track and assess program outcomes through data collection and participant feedback.
    • Use data to continuously improve programs and ensure they meet the evolving needs of youth participants.
    • Assess the individual needs of families and formulate strategies to meet those needs in a timely and cost-effective manner.
    • Performs other duties as assigned.

    QUALIFICATIONS:

    • A College degree in Social Work, Education, Youth Development, Psychology, or a related field.
    • At least 2-3 years of experience working in youth development and family engagement, inclusive of lived experience.
    • Experience (trained or lived) in health care & education systems.
    • Demonstrated experience facilitating workshops, events, and youth and community outreach activities.
    • Ability to effectively interact and communicate with youth and diverse communities.
    • Ability to communicate and work effectively within a team and in partnership with other organizations.
    • Ability to problem solve.
    • Ability to plan and manage multiple tasks and meet deadlines
    • Ability to work flexible hours (e.g., attend community meetings, conferences, or events)
    • Intermediate knowledge of standard software applications (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Publisher) and ability to use Internet Browsers (Chrome, Edge, etc.), web-based applications, and data management systems (e.g., Salesforce)
    • Intermediate knowledge of programs, email, and blogging platforms (preferred).

    P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S:

    • Familiarity with the unique challenges facing the DC youth community
